	Beechcraft A36 Propjet "Bonanza" light six-seat single

A development of the original V tailed Bonanza, the model 36 offered improvements to fit into the niche for which the original aircraft was becomeing outdated.  Fitted with six seats, the 36 was first released in 1968 and offered high fast flight and excellent handling.  The turboprop development, (the A36TC) was produced from 1979 to 1981 when the B36TC was offered.  With over 3,000 produced and still being made, the 36 is one of the rare long-term GA success stories.  

Specifications:
Wingspan: 37 feet 1 inche
Length: 29 feet s inches
Height: 8 feet 7 inches
Wing area: 181 square feet
Weight: 2,400 pounds empty, 3,833 pounds max takeoff weight
Capacity: one pilot, six passengers
Useful load: 1,215 pounds
Powerplant: One Allison 250B17F2 turbine propshaft engine developing 450 shp to drive a three bladed constant speed Hartzell propeller
Service ceiling: 25,000 feet
Cruise speed: 220 knots at 15,000 feet
Initial rate of climb: 2,500 feet/minute
Max Range: 1,065 nm
